Hyderabad: Car catches fire on Khairatabad Road, no casualties reported

A car caught fire on Khairatabad Road in Hyderabad on Sunday night, causing panic. The driver escaped safely, and a fire tender extinguished the flames. Officials suspect a short circuit as the cause. No casualties were reported.

Hyderabad: Panic broke out for a while at Khairatabad Road in the city on Sunday night after a fire broke out in a car. No casualties were reported.

According to the police, the car was on the run on the Khairatabad metro station road when flames burst in the car. On noticing the fire, the car driver rushed out of the car, and within minutes the fire rapidly spread and engulfed the car.


A fire tender reached the spot and doused the flames. The officials suspect the fire started due to a short circuit in the vehicle.
